    Scalpels, Scrapers & Blades – Precision Cutting Guide

    Types of scalpels and their applications

    Scalpels differ in blade length, thickness and locking mechanism. Models like the BORMANN PRO Scalpel 168mm with longer bodies provide better control when cutting thicker materials such as cardboard, linoleum or drywall. For precision work in modeling and crafts, scalpels with thin blades that allow cuts down to the millimeter are recommended.

    Trapezoid and universal blades

    Trapezoid blades are the most common choice for construction and craft work because they allow quick snapping off of dull sections and replacement with fresh edges. Brands like BOSCH and MILWAUKEE offer reinforced blades with carbon steel that withstand working with abrasive materials. Universal blades with rotational mechanisms allow changing sides without removing from the holder.

    Specialized blades for specific tasks

    For working with floor coverings, hook blades are used to prevent damage to the material underneath. Brands like KNIPEX and FISKARS produce ceramic blades that don't rust and are ideal for working with adhesive tapes or insulation materials. For electronics and precision assembly, blades with thickness under 0.5mm are required.

    Scrapers – types and usage

    Scrapers are divided into manual and electric models depending on the scope of work. Manual scrapers with replaceable blades like those from DELI or LUX TOOLS ranges are suitable for removing paint, glue or wallpaper residue. Electric scrapers enable faster work on large surfaces but require careful handling to avoid damaging the substrate.

    Scraper blades – materials and shapes

    Scraper blades can be straight, wavy or serrated depending on the material type. Straight blades are used for glass and ceramics, wavy for tiles with adhesive residue, and serrated for wood and walls. Quality blades made from alloyed steel from brands like HOGERT and FALKET retain sharpness even after multiple sharpenings.

    Safety and tool maintenance

    Always use scalpels with auto-retracting blade systems or safety caps when not in use. Replace dull blades regularly as excessive pressure can lead to slipping and injuries. Store tools in specialized cases that prevent accidental blade activation and protect both you and your tools from damage.
